How pet care businesses can prepare for changing safety expectations, evolving regulations, infection control challenges, sustainability goals, and the future of animal care operations.


Annette Uda is the founder and president of Aerapy Animal Health and a member of the IBPSA Board of Advisors. Since 2008, she has worked with animal care facilities to improve indoor air quality, reduce disease transmission risk, and support healthier environments for pets, staff, and clients through research-backed UVGI/GUV air and surface disinfection technology.

 

Annette is a published writer, speaker, and educator in the animal care industry. She also serves on ASHRAE technical committees focused on ultraviolet air and surface treatment, contributing to the advancement of standards and best practices for air disinfection. Her work combines practical facility experience with science-based infection control strategies to help pet care businesses prepare for the future of animal health and facility operations.
